Output 815649256752d387b490c5803cae602913e2fb6d1e9997cdd00688a702043609: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033e91188f53c57164d6636892cd4c1d40b20da4 OP_EQUAL
address
31zAuLQYRbvDJUx5Zua8KmsTQfGDo9jqC7
transaction
815649256752d387b490c5803cae602913e2fb6d1e9997cdd00688a702043609
spent
true